FAQs on Radhe Developers (India) Ltd. Shareprice

Radhe Developers has given better returns compared to its competitors.
Radhe Developers has grown at ~-16.38% over the last 2yrs while peers have grown at a median rate of -28.96%

Radhe Developers is not expensive.
Latest PE of Radhe Developers is 18.81, while 3 year average PE is 26.28.
Also latest EV/EBITDA of Radhe Developers is 18.28 while 3yr average is 326.

FAQs on Radhe Developers (India) Ltd. Financials

Radhe Developers balance sheet is weak and might have solvency issues

Yes, The net debt of Radhe Developers is increasing.
Latest net debt of Radhe Developers is ₹35.29 Crs as of Sep-25.
This is greater than Mar-25 when it was ₹34.38 Crs.

Yes, profit is increasing.
The profit of Radhe Developers is ₹5.54 Crs for TTM, ₹1.42 Crs for Mar 2025 and -₹4.63 Crs for Mar 2024.

The company seems to be paying a very low dividend.
Investors need to see where the company is allocating its profits.
Radhe Developers latest dividend payout ratio is 0% and 3yr average dividend payout ratio is 0%

Companies resources are allocated to majorly unproductive assets like Inventory, Short Term Loans & Advances
